Jim Gray
James Gray is Co-founder and Chairman of optionsXpress Holdings, Inc., the online options, futures and stock brokerage. Since taking its first customer in January 2001, optionsXpress has fundamentally changed how retail investors use exchange-traded derivatives for investing and strategic portfolio management.
Gray, with 20 years in the options industry, is also President of G-Bar L.P., one of the nation’s largest independent options trading firms.
Gray is active in many civic and professional organizations, serving on the boards of the Shedd Aquarium, Children’s Memorial and the Chicago Museum of Science & Industry. He is also a member of the Young Presidents Organization, the Chicagoland Entrepreneurial Center, the Executives Club and the Economic Club of Chicago.
Through the Avrum Gray Family Fund and the G-Bar Foundation, Gray is also a supporter of the Chicago Botanic Gardens, Chicago Symphony, Jewish United Fund, Lyric Opera House, Gene Siskel Film Center, the Ravinia Festival and the “Chicago 2016” effort to bring the Olympics to Chicago.
Gray holds a B.S. in Finance and Economics from the University of Iowa.
Brett Tolman
Brett graduated with honors from Stanford University with an undergraduate degree in economics. He has worked as a trader in the options industry for 17 years. Brett started his career with Group One in 1994, moved to PEAK6 in 1999, and joined G-Bar in 2002.
Rod Levy
Rod graduated from Cornell University with undergraduate and Master’s degrees in engineering. He has worked as a trader in the options industry for 17 years. Rod started his career with Hull Trading in 1994 and joined G-Bar in 1996. He earned his MBA from the University of Chicago in 1999.
